Optimal placement of security camera
description This research studies the optimization on the placement of security camera. We need to improve the field of view (FOV) coverage of a security camera by only adjusting the location of cameras with minimal numbers of cameras. Two dimensional of floor plan was designed in boundary nodes and internal nodes. Cameras were installed at boundary node in order to view the internal nodes. We propose Binary Integer Programming method which can efficiently find an optimal layout for each camera. Heuristic method of Particle Swarm Optimization (PSO) algorithm is applied on this problem. As a result of this optimization, the FOV coverage of the whole camera network is maximized. This study show that the proposed PSO method perform well and effectively applied in placement of security camera on any design of floor plan.
